Transaction 96bab52a4d04e337eaf64d9dcabafaa08bd21dd250a25c361eb73e3bdec2c42b
1 Input
1 Output
-
96bab52a4d04e337eaf64d9dcabafaa08bd21dd250a25c361eb73e3bdec2c42b:0
- value
- 582694
- script pubkey
- OP_0 OP_PUSHBYTES_20 734485b26dae95d7e6935a39014518682be72c4a
- address
- bc1qwdzgtvnd462a0e5ntgusz3gcdq47wtz29uyx2s